Cookies and Similar Tracking Devices

 

Because we employ cookies and similar tracking tools, we wanted to provide you with some additional information what they are and how they affect you.  

 

A cookie is a piece of information, which may include a unique identifier, that is sent to your Internet browser from a server and stored on your hard drive or device. We assign a different cookie to each device that accesses our Website. Cookies allow your devices to use all the features on our Website, such as remembering who you are, knowing if you have visited our site before or if you are a first-time visitor, and remembering if you clicked on a specific link. Cookies do not contain specific information about you or any device you are using.  

 

You are always free to decline our cookies and you may be able to set your Internet browser to refuse all or some browser cookies, or to alert you when cookies are being sent. If you disable or refuse cookies, please note that some parts of our Website may be inaccessible or not function properly.

ADDITIONAL PRIVACY RIGHTS FOR CALIFORNIA RESIDENTS

  

As discussed in this Privacy Policy, we may from time to time elect to share your Personal Information with third parties for those third parties’ direct marketing purposes. Under California Civil Code § 1798.83, California residents are entitled to ask us for a notice describing what categories of Personal Information we share with third parties for their direct marketing purposes. That notice will identify the categories of Personal Information shared with third parties and used for direct marketing purposes and the name and address of the third parties that received such Personal Information. If you are a California resident and would like a copy of this notice, please submit a written request to Kalorama Partners at the following address (limit one request per year): info@kaloramapartners.com. You must include your full name, email address, and postal address in your request. Please allow thirty (30) days for us to respond. 

 

ADDITIONAL PRIVACY RIGHTS FOR EUROPEAN UNION RESIDENTS

 

Following the European Union’s passage of the General Data Protection Regulation (“GDPR”), Users residing in the European Union have the right to manage the Personal Information we collect from you while using our Website and related Services. These rights include the following:  

 

  • Right to be forgotten: you may request we delete all of your Personal Information without undue delay. 

  • Right to object: you may prohibit certain Personal Information uses. 

  • Right to rectification: you may request that incomplete Personal Information be completed or that incorrect information be corrected. 

  • Right of access: you have the right to know what Personal Information is being processed and how. 

  • Right of portability: you may request that Personal Information held by us be transported to another entity.
